A pilot metric should support a decision
AI Builder pilots are easy to measure badly. Teams count generated answers, number of users, demo reactions, prompt versions, or how many workflows were attempted. Those numbers can be useful context, but they do not answer the main question.
Should this workflow expand, continue narrowly, change direction, or stop?
A pilot metric should support that decision. It should help the business owner, AI Builder, users, and technical partners understand whether the workflow is becoming useful, trustworthy, maintainable, and worth more investment.
This is different from proving that AI is exciting. A pilot can produce impressive output and still fail as a workflow. It can also produce modest output and still be valuable if it reduces repeated work, makes review easier, and reveals a scalable pattern.
The goal is not to build a complicated analytics system before the first release. The goal is to collect the few signals that reveal whether the workflow deserves the next step.
Start with the decision you need to make
Before choosing metrics, write the decision the pilot is meant to support.
For example:
After four weeks, we need to decide whether the support answer assistant should expand from five agents to the full support team, continue only for onboarding questions, or pause until source material is improved.
That decision implies useful metrics: agent usage, accepted and edited suggestions, source coverage, escalation accuracy, error categories, time saved, and unresolved source gaps.
A different pilot needs different metrics:
After six weeks, we need to decide whether the sales research assistant should move from manual account briefs to CRM-integrated prep notes.
That decision needs evidence about rep adoption, CRM field quality, public-source reliability, time saved before calls, edit patterns, and whether the output fits the sales routine.
Do not use one generic AI dashboard for every workflow. Support, sales, recruiting, finance, product feedback, and legal workflows do not fail in the same way.
Track intended-user adoption, not audience applause
The first useful metric is whether the intended users actually use the workflow.
Not observers. Not executives watching a demo. Not people clicking once out of curiosity. The users who perform the work.
Useful adoption signals go beyond a login count. Look at the percentage of intended users who tried the workflow, whether the same users came back, whether usage happened during real work instead of test sessions, where drop-off appeared after the first week, and why some users chose not to use it.
Low adoption is not automatically the AI Builder's fault. It may mean the workflow is in the wrong tool, the output appears too late, the source material is weak, managers did not create time to test, or users do not trust the review process.
That is why adoption should be paired with user notes. "Only two of five agents used it" is a fact. "Three agents said copying ticket context into a separate tool was slower than manual search" is a diagnosis.
Adoption is a workflow metric, not a popularity contest.
Measure accepted, edited, rejected, and escalated output
For many AI-assisted workflows, the most useful early metric is how users handle the output.
Track how much the output actually helped. Was it accepted without meaningful edit, accepted after a small edit, heavily rewritten, rejected, escalated to a human owner, flagged for missing or wrong source, or ignored because it arrived too late or in the wrong place?
This is stronger than asking whether users "liked" the tool. It shows how much useful work the AI actually contributed.
The categories should match the workflow. A support draft may be accepted, edited, or escalated. A finance pre-check may be confirmed, corrected, or routed to exception review. A product feedback packet may have themes accepted, split, renamed, or rejected by the product manager.
Do not hide edited outputs inside "success." A lightly edited output may be useful. A heavily edited output may still save time. But the difference matters because it tells you whether to improve source quality, prompt format, retrieval, interface design, or scope.
Separate error categories
AI pilot feedback becomes useful when errors are categorized.
Avoid one bucket called "bad output." It does not tell the AI Builder what to fix.
Common categories include wrong or stale source, missing source, retrieval finding the wrong material, unusable output format, missing workflow context, or a business rule that was never clear. Some errors are more serious: the AI answered when it should have asked for clarification, failed to escalate a high-risk case, or led a user into reviewing output without understanding the review responsibility. Other errors simply reveal that the use case was out of scope.
These categories lead to different actions. A stale source needs a source owner. A bad format needs product or prompt work. Missing context may require integration. Unclear business rules require a business owner, not a model change.
This is where mature AI Builder work becomes visible. The builder should not treat every complaint as a prompt problem. They should turn user feedback into an operating diagnosis.
Measure source quality, not only answer quality
Many AI pilots fail because the inputs are weak. If the source material is stale, conflicting, incomplete, or unowned, the model may produce confident but unreliable output.
Useful source metrics show whether the workflow can be trusted at the next scope. Track how often pilot outputs cite an approved source, how often source failures occur, and where approved sources conflict. Note stale documents discovered during the pilot, source updates required before expansion, and questions blocked because no owner could confirm policy.
For a support workflow, this may reveal help center gaps. For a sales workflow, it may reveal CRM quality problems. For a legal workflow, it may reveal that playbooks are not specific enough. For product feedback, it may reveal that customer segment context is missing.
Do not blame the AI Builder for every source problem. But do expect the AI Builder to make source problems visible.
A pilot that exposes source weakness can still be successful if the company learns what foundation work is needed before expansion.
Track review burden
Human review is not free. A pilot can look accurate but create too much review work.
Measure the real review burden: time required to review output, the number of fields or claims users must verify, whether review is easier than doing the work manually, which cases require specialist review, whether reviewers trust the source display, and whether the review step fits the existing workflow.
For example, an AI assistant that drafts a support reply may save writing time but add source verification time. That can still be worthwhile if total effort falls and risk is controlled. But if agents must inspect five sources, rewrite most of the answer, and manually log feedback, the workflow may not be ready.
Review burden also affects expansion. A workflow that works for five agents with one supervisor may fail at 50 agents if review capacity does not scale.
The question is not whether human review exists. The question is whether the review model is sustainable for the next scope.
Include risk and trust signals
Some pilot metrics should be about what should not happen.
Track the events that should not happen: sensitive data shown to the wrong user, customer-visible output sent without required approval, high-risk cases that were not escalated, missing audit trails for reviewed decisions, unauthorized source access, outputs crossing legal, HR, finance, security, or policy boundaries, and users copying outputs without review when review was required.
Even one high-severity event may matter more than many successful low-risk outputs.
This is why pilot reporting should not average everything into a single score. A 95% helpfulness rating can hide one unacceptable failure. A workflow that handles 200 low-risk cases well may still be unready if it mishandles a small number of high-risk cases.
Risk metrics help the company decide scope. The answer may be "expand low-risk categories, but keep high-risk cases excluded."
Measure maintenance load
A pilot does not end when the first users like it. The company needs to know what it will cost to keep the workflow useful.
Measure maintenance load in the same practical way. How many source updates were required? How much time went into triaging feedback? How many prompt or retrieval changes were made? How many evaluation examples were added? How many support questions came from users? How often did access changes or owner decisions block improvement?
This matters because a workflow can be useful and still too expensive to maintain at the next scale. If every small change requires the AI Builder to manually inspect logs, rewrite prompts, update sources, retrain users, and explain behavior, expansion may need a stronger operating model first.
Maintenance load also clarifies staffing. If one AI Builder is already maintaining two live workflows, starting a third may be unrealistic unless ownership is shared.
Use qualitative evidence with metrics
Numbers alone can create false confidence. Pair metrics with short examples.
A useful pilot report includes:
Metric:
What happened:
Representative example:
Likely cause:
Decision implication:
For example:
Metric:
32% of rejected support suggestions were missing required escalation language.
Representative example:
Billing dispute questions used the general refund article but did not include supervisor-review language.
Likely cause:
Escalation rules live in internal notes, not the approved help center source.
Decision implication:
Do not expand billing coverage until escalation source ownership is resolved.
This kind of evidence turns metrics into decisions. It prevents the team from arguing over whether "32%" is good or bad without understanding the underlying workflow issue.
Avoid shallow success metrics
Be careful with metrics that make the pilot look productive without proving value.
Weak metrics are usually activity counts dressed up as progress: number of AI outputs generated, prompts written, documents indexed, workflows brainstormed, or demo attendees. Average model response ratings are also weak when they are not tied to error categories. Broad time-saving claims are weak when there is no baseline.
These numbers are not useless, but they should not carry the decision.
Processing 10,000 documents means little if the workflow only needs 40 approved sources. Generating 1,000 summaries means little if users do not trust them. A demo with enthusiastic reactions means little if the first users never adopt it.
A good AI Builder pilot should prefer fewer, sharper metrics over a larger dashboard that hides the decision.
Build a pilot decision report
At the end of the pilot, produce a short decision report.
Use this structure:
Workflow:
Pilot users:
Pilot period:
Supported cases:
Excluded cases:
Adoption:
Accepted / edited / rejected / escalated outputs:
Top error categories:
Source quality findings:
Review burden:
Risk events:
Maintenance load:
User feedback summary:
Business owner decision:
Recommendation: expand / continue narrowly / pause / stop / choose a different workflow
The report should not be a marketing artifact. It should be useful even if the recommendation is to stop.
If the pilot is successful, the report explains why expansion is reasonable. If the pilot is mixed, it explains what must change. If the pilot fails, it prevents the company from learning the wrong lesson.
The best pilot reports make the next decision easier, not the previous work look better.
Let metrics shape the next workflow
Pilot metrics should feed directly into the next step.
If adoption was strong but source quality was weak, the next project may be source cleanup or documentation workflow.
If source quality was strong but review burden was high, the next project may be interface or workflow placement.
If users accepted outputs but risk cases failed, expansion should exclude those categories until escalation rules improve.
If the AI Builder spent too much time maintaining the workflow manually, the company may need ownership design before starting a second workflow.
If the pilot exposed no reusable pattern, the company should be cautious about treating it as a foundation for scale.
Metrics are not only for judging the AI Builder. They are for deciding how the company should work with AI next.
The best metric is a better decision
An AI Builder pilot succeeds when the company can make a clearer decision than it could before.
That decision may be expansion. It may be a narrower release. It may be source cleanup. It may be a different workflow. It may be stopping.
All of those can be good outcomes if they are based on evidence.
The weak outcome is not "we stopped." The weak outcome is "we are not sure what happened, but the demo looked good."
